Market Chatter: Lynas Rare Earths Discussed Earlier Takeover Talks That Did Not Proceed, Says Reuters

Lynas Rare Earths (ASX:LYC) held takeover discussions earlier this year that ultimately did not progress, Reuters reported late Wednesday, citing a company spokesperson.

Chairman John Humphrey told investors at briefings that the talks had prompted the company to pause its search for a new chief executive to succeed Amanda Lacaze, who retired in June, the report added, citing three unnamed people.
